Transaction 62f1ec423ac3e6870066cdb46febcaa5a2aee2dbff8eacaae46c01307f83aefe
1 Input
1 Output
-
62f1ec423ac3e6870066cdb46febcaa5a2aee2dbff8eacaae46c01307f83aefe:0
- value
- 172041
- script pubkey
- OP_0 OP_PUSHBYTES_32 dfeb45a2e599cca9fbedba8ce85e8544e75488edc8eea2720e6d407bb7f73fac
- address
- bc1qml45tgh9n8x2n7ldh2xwsh59gnn4fz8derh2yuswd4q8hdlh87kqw4ujcv